Bushmills, has announced the launch of a new limited-edition range of rare and unique Irish single malt whiskeys, inspired by the natural wonders of the Giant’s Causeway.
The Bushmills Causeway Collection, which is comprised of ten
different expressions available in nine different countries, includes the 2001
Feuillette Cask available exclusively in the UK.
Bushmills 2001 Feuillette Cask |
Bushmills 2001 Feuillette Cask (49% ABV) was matured for over 17 years in Oloroso sherry butts and Bourbon barrels, before final maturation for over two years in a rare Burgundy feuillette wine casks.
The Causeway Collection has been expertly crafted by
Bushmills Master Blender, Helen Mulholland. Several of the casks used in the
collection, where laid down to mature in the early 1990’s, when Helen started
her internship at The Old Bushmills Distillery.
Bushmills 2001 Feuillette Cask, is the first cask strength
release and first red wine cask-matured whiskey ever to be made available by
Bushmills in the UK.
The Bushmills Causeway Collection, which launches globally,
also includes expressions finished in new American oak, Cognac, Muscatel and
Marsala casks.

Limited to 168, Bushmills 2001 Feuillette Cask will be available from December 7th, from The Whisky Shop for a RRP of £200.00.
